Aller au contenu
  • Pas encore inscrit ?

    Pourquoi ne pas vous inscrire ? C'est simple, rapide et gratuit.
    Pour en savoir plus, lisez Les avantages de l'inscription... et la Charte de Zébulon.
    De plus, les messages que vous postez en tant qu'invité restent invisibles tant qu'un modérateur ne les a pas validés. Inscrivez-vous, ce sera un gain de temps pour tout le monde, vous, les helpeurs et les modérateurs ! :wink:

Messages recommandés

Posté(e)

pour limiter la liste aux modules liés au son :

modprobe -l | grep sound

 

vérifie que la version du kernel qui apparait dans le chemin des modules est la bonne.

 

On ne sait jamais, vérifie l'installation des composants d'alsa :

apt-get install alsa

apt-get install alsa-utils

 

 

J'avais déja fait la recherche, et effectivement, le module n'est pas présent sur le disque.

Mais il doit y voir un moyen de l'installer ?

En tout cas, avec un apt-cache search snd-hda, il ne trouve rien.

Sinon, j'ai trouvé ça , mais il doit bien y avoir un site "officiel".

 

Pour alsa, les deux étaient bien installés.

Posté(e)

J'avais déja fait la recherche, et effectivement, le module n'est pas présent sur le disque.

Mais il doit y voir un moyen de l'installer ?

En tout cas, avec un apt-cache search snd-hda, il ne trouve rien.

Sinon, j'ai trouvé ça , mais il doit bien y avoir un site "officiel".

 

Pour alsa, les deux étaient bien installés.

essaie toujours d'installer alsa-modules-2.4-686, il contient bien snd-hda-intel.o

mais le problème c'est que le paquet alsa-modules n'existe pas pour les noyaux 2.6

Posté(e)

essaie toujours d'installer alsa-modules-2.4-686, il contient bien snd-hda-intel.o

mais le problème c'est que le paquet alsa-modules n'existe pas pour les noyaux 2.6

 

 

Je l'ai installé, mais qunad je fais un :

find / -name snd-hda-intel.o

il ne me trouve rien. (la commande de recherche est bonne ?)

 

Un insmod snd-hda-intel ne donne rien non plus.

Posté(e)

Ça sert à rien d'installer des drivers compilés pour un autre noyau(on ne sait pas encore que version tu as (uname -r). Le link que KewlCat t'a donné devrait suffir.

Cherche le module, c'est bizarre qu'il ne soit pas déjà installé:

updatedb

locate snd-hda-intel

S'il est installé , simplement chargue le avec

modprobe snd-hda-intel;modprobe snd-pcm-oss;modprobe snd-mixer-oss;modprobe snd-seq-oss

Utilise modprobe, pas insmod. insmod normalement a besoin du path complet, non seulememt le nom du module.

Sinon il te faudra compiler les modules..ATTENTION, seulement les modules, pas un nouveau noyau. (dans ce cas installer le paquet kernel-headers qui correspond à ton noyau,gcc,make,etc)

Saluts

Posté(e) (modifié)

Ça sert à rien d'installer des drivers compilés pour un autre noyau(on ne sait pas encore que version tu as (uname -r).

Pour la version, c'est le 2.6.8-2-386.

 

 

Cherche le module, c'est bizarre qu'il ne soit pas déjà installé:

updatedb

locate snd-hda-intel

S'il est installé , simplement chargue le avec

modprobe snd-hda-intel;modprobe snd-pcm-oss;modprobe snd-mixer-oss;modprobe snd-seq-oss

Le locate ne donne rien, donc forcement modprobe snd-hda-intel ne passe pas. Par contre les autres commandes fonctionnent.

 

 

Sinon il te faudra compiler les modules..ATTENTION, seulement les modules, pas un nouveau noyau. (dans ce cas installer le paquet kernel-headers qui correspond à ton noyau,gcc,make,etc)

C'est en cours d'installation. Mais je fais quoi avec ?

 

 

Le link que KewlCat t'a donné devrait suffir.

Surement, malheuresement, je n'ai pas tout compris. (mais ce n'est pas faute d'avoir essayé)

Modifié par PaTaToR
Posté(e)

salut

 

adduser toto audio

 

tu l'as fait ?

Je l'avais pas fait mais de toutes façon, quand j'essaye, il me dit que florent (enfin, je suppose qu'il fallait que je remplace toto par l'utilisateur) est deja dans le groupe audio.

Posté(e)

Ça serait quelque chose pareille:

apt-get install kernel-headers-2.6.8-2-386 gcc make kernel-package

Attention, la version de gcc doit être celle avec ton noyau a été compilé, comment savoir? : cat /proc/version

Tu peut avoir plusieurs versions de gcc, seulement il te faut la specifier sur ligne des commandes au moment de compiler, ou bien créer le symlink /usr/bin/gcc qui pointe vers la version désirée, par example si ton noyau a été compilé avec gcc-2.95, et tu as des autres versions de gcc, tu t'assures d'utiliser la version 2.95 comme ça:

ln -sf /usr/bin/gcc-2.95 /usr/bin/gcc

Pour voir ou pointe ton gcc actuel ls -l /usr/bin/gcc

Après installer kernel-headers, tu doit créer (s'il n'existe déjà), un autre symlink (usr/src/linux), qui pointe vers les kernel headers recement installés:

ln -sf /usr/src/linux /usr/src/linux-headers-2.6.8.2-386

 

Maintenant tu peut commencer dès topic "Quick Install" sur le link de Kewlcat.

Saluts!!!

Posté(e) (modifié)

Pour la version, c'est le 2.6.8-2-386.

C'est bien ce que j'avais compris. Ce que je ne comprends pas c'est le fait qu'il n'existe pas de paquets installables correspondant à alsa-modules-2.6.8-2.386 :P

Je n'ai pas tout suivi en ce qui concerne l'évolution du kernel, mais c'est possible que l'utilisation des modules ait changé depuis le noyau 2.4 ce qui expliquerait celà... Si quelqu'un à l'info ?

Le locate ne donne rien

c'est normal : locate recherche les noms de fichiers dans une table, ce qui permet de trouver plus rapidement le résultat qu'avec find, seulement pour mettre cette table à jour, il faut lancer :

updatedb

qui elle-même utilise find. Quand tu télécharges ou installes des fichiers, cette table n'est pas mise à jour ce qui explique que tu ne trouves pas les nouveaux fichiers :P

Modifié par mediaforest
Posté(e)

17:32 florent@debian ~% ls -l /usr/bin/gcc
lrwxrwxrwx  1 root root 7 Mar  4 18:05 /usr/bin/gcc -> gcc-3.3*
17:32 florent@debian ~% cat /proc/version
Linux version 2.6.8-2-386 (horms@tabatha.lab.ultramonkey.org) (gcc version 3.3.5 (Debian 1:3.3.5-13)) #1 Tue Aug 16 12:46:35 UTC 2005

 

Donc là, apparement, au niveau de la version, ça colle ! :P

 

Aprés, je fais un : ln -sf /usr/src/linux /usr/src/linux-headers-2.6.8.2-386

Tout fonctionne bien.

 

Et là, j'attaque la page de Kewlcat au niveau de Quick Install :

Première chose, je ne sais pas si j'utilise cvs.

Qu'à cella ne tienne, j'essaye tout. Mais pas de chance, y'a aucune des trois commandes qui ne fonctionnent.

17:35 florent@debian ~% ./configure
zsh: aucun fichier ou répertoire de ce type: ./configure
zsh: exit 127   ./configure
17:35 florent@debian ~% ./cvscompile
zsh: aucun fichier ou répertoire de ce type: ./cvscompile
zsh: exit 127   ./cvscompile
17:35 florent@debian ~% make build
make: *** No rule to make target `build'.  Stop.
zsh: exit 2	 make build

 

Apres, je crée mon repertoire /usr/src/alsa, mais au moment de la copie, nouveau problème, le repertoire source n'existe pas.

Je suppose que j'aurais du telecharger qques chose, genre les sources de alsa. Ou je peux les trouver ? Et quelle version je prend ?

Rejoindre la conversation

Vous publiez en tant qu’invité.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.
Remarque : votre message nécessitera l’approbation d’un modérateur avant de pouvoir être visible.

Invité
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

  • En ligne récemment   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
×
×
  • Créer...